To start off, here's an exert of numbers I collected from back in July 2011 just when PC3 came into force. (You can refresh your memory here: viewtopic.php?f=16&t=3630&start=150)
Code: Select all
Betfair Betdaq
11/07/2011 40,814,893 3,793,391 9%
12/07/2011 53,259,295 4,565,514 9%
14/07/2011 50,197,199 5,019,784 10%
18/07/2011 32,531,864 5,538,041 17%
19/07/2011 37,830,923 5,917,488 16%
21/07/2011 45,026,465 6,811,765 15%
29/07/2011 62,343,713 11,439,640 18%
Here are the two days I collected recently:
Code: Select all
BF BF as BD BD
Fri 15/11/2013 12,976,395 45,589,529 4,837,263 11%
Mon 02/12/2013 7,729,548 26,220,456 2,752,589 10%
So in the two sample days, I have to say volume-wise things look very similar to over 2 years ago. Of course we're comparing different seasons here.
In the end, volume doesn't show the whole picture since, like Peter W, I have suddenly found that a strategy that didn't previously work is now working for me on Betdaq.
